Technical Problem

Current packaging materials for liquid food cartons, particularly those used for aseptic packaging, rely heavily on aluminum foil for gas barrier properties. However, there is a need for sustainable, cost-effective alternatives that can replicate the barrier properties of aluminum foil while being recyclable and environmentally friendly.

Method used

A method for producing a barrier-coated substrate using reduced graphene oxide, which involves coating a substrate web with an aqueous composition containing a reducing agent and a water-dispersible polymer, followed by the application of graphene oxide flakes. The reduction reaction continues even after drying, providing excellent gas barrier properties without the need for wet treatments or high-temperature processes.

Benefits of technology

The resulting laminate packaging material exhibits superior oxygen barrier properties, making it suitable for long-term aseptic packaging of liquid foods. It is cost-effective, recyclable, and maintains its integrity during processing and storage, addressing the limitations of traditional aluminum foil-based packaging.

Abstract

The present invention relates to a method for producing a barrier-coated substrate web (10; 25a) coated with a first layer (12a) of a reducing agent and a water-dispersible polymer and a second layer (13a) of reduced graphene oxide. The present invention further relates to a laminate packaging material (20a) comprising the barrier-coated substrate web (10), in particular intended for liquid carton food packaging, and to a liquid carton packaging container made of this laminate packaging material.
